Clean, green eco-future draws closer


A

ustralian researchers have brought the long-awaited dream of an economy running on hydrogen fuel a step closer by developing a device that generates zero-emission fuels from the sun's rays.

The solar-powered fuel cell, which converts chemical energy into electricity, produces hydrogen fuel at 22 per cent energy efficiency, breaking the previous world record of 18 per cent.
